Opennet munin: Unterschied zwischen den Versionen

Aus Opennet
Wechseln zu: Navigation, Suche
(Datemsammlung auf howmei)
(Datenerfassung auf Servern (Debian))
 
(6 dazwischenliegende Versionen von einem Benutzer werden nicht angezeigt)
Zeile 4: Zeile 4:
 
Munin besteht aus einer Komponente zur Erzeugung/Erfassung (Debian-Paket ''munin-node'') von Daten und einer Komponente zur Sammlung und Visualisierung dieser Informationen von einem oder mehreren Rechnern (Debian-Paket ''munin'').
 
Munin besteht aus einer Komponente zur Erzeugung/Erfassung (Debian-Paket ''munin-node'') von Daten und einer Komponente zur Sammlung und Visualisierung dieser Informationen von einem oder mehreren Rechnern (Debian-Paket ''munin'').
  
= Setup-Varianten =
+
Auf mehreren [[Opennet Server|Opennet-Server]]n sind sowohl die erfassende als auch die sammelnde Komponente installiert - sie arbeiten also autonom. Zusätzlich sammelt [[Server/howmei]] zentral die Daten von vielen Servern und APs. Technische Details unter [[Server Installation/munin]].
Auf mehreren [[Opennet Server|Opennet-Server]]n sind sowohl die erfassende als auch die sammelnde Komponente installiert - sie arbeiten also autonom. Zusätzlich sammelt [[Server/howmei]] zentral die Daten von vielen Servern und APs.
+
  
== Autonomes Setup ==
+
== Eigene Monitoring Installation ==
 
In einem Debian-System werden durch die Installation des Pakets ''munin'' beide Komponenten installiert und sind anschließend via http://localhost/munin erreichbar.
 
In einem Debian-System werden durch die Installation des Pakets ''munin'' beide Komponenten installiert und sind anschließend via http://localhost/munin erreichbar.
  
 
Um die Erreichbarkeit von außen zu ermöglich, müssen in der Datei ''/etc/munin/apache2.conf'' die Zeilen ''Require local'' auskommentiert werden.
 
Um die Erreichbarkeit von außen zu ermöglich, müssen in der Datei ''/etc/munin/apache2.conf'' die Zeilen ''Require local'' auskommentiert werden.
  
== Zentrales Setup ==
+
== Opennet Monitoring ==
 
Die folgenden beiden Abschnitte beschreiben die Installation der Datenerfassungskomponente auf APs oder auf Servern.
 
Die folgenden beiden Abschnitte beschreiben die Installation der Datenerfassungskomponente auf APs oder auf Servern.
  
Zeile 20: Zeile 19:
 
* den Dienst neustarten: <pre>service munin-node restart</pre>
 
* den Dienst neustarten: <pre>service munin-node restart</pre>
  
=== Datenerfassung auf Access Points (openwrt) ===
+
Hinweis: Sollte unterhalb von ''/home'' ein Mount-Point bestehen, so muss für das DF (Disk Free) Monitoring eine Anpassung vorgenommen werden, siehe [https://dev.opennet-initiative.de/ticket/235 Opennet DEV Ticket 235].
 +
 
 +
=== Datenerfassung auf Access Points (OpenWrt) ===
 
* Paket installieren: <pre>opkg install muninlite</pre>
 
* Paket installieren: <pre>opkg install muninlite</pre>
 
* Dienst aktivieren: <pre>/etc/init.d/xinetd enable; /etc/init.d/xinetd start</pre>
 
* Dienst aktivieren: <pre>/etc/init.d/xinetd enable; /etc/init.d/xinetd start</pre>
  
=== Datemsammlung auf howmei ===
+
=== Datenerfassung auf Access Points (Opennet Firmware) ===
  
Siehe [[Server Installation/munin]].
+
* hierzu das "on-monitoring" Modul installieren
  
 
[[Kategorie:Dienste]]
 
[[Kategorie:Dienste]]
 
[[Kategorie:Verein]]
 
[[Kategorie:Verein]]

Aktuelle Version vom 4. Januar 2020, 21:33 Uhr

Inhaltsverzeichnis

[Bearbeiten] Überblick

Munin ist ein Dienst zur Aufzeichnung von System-Zuständen und zur Visualisierung derselben.

Munin besteht aus einer Komponente zur Erzeugung/Erfassung (Debian-Paket munin-node) von Daten und einer Komponente zur Sammlung und Visualisierung dieser Informationen von einem oder mehreren Rechnern (Debian-Paket munin).

Auf mehreren Opennet-Servern sind sowohl die erfassende als auch die sammelnde Komponente installiert - sie arbeiten also autonom. Zusätzlich sammelt Server/howmei zentral die Daten von vielen Servern und APs. Technische Details unter Server Installation/munin.

[Bearbeiten] Eigene Monitoring Installation

In einem Debian-System werden durch die Installation des Pakets munin beide Komponenten installiert und sind anschließend via http://localhost/munin erreichbar.

Um die Erreichbarkeit von außen zu ermöglich, müssen in der Datei /etc/munin/apache2.conf die Zeilen Require local auskommentiert werden.

[Bearbeiten] Opennet Monitoring

Die folgenden beiden Abschnitte beschreiben die Installation der Datenerfassungskomponente auf APs oder auf Servern.

[Bearbeiten] Datenerfassung auf Servern (Debian)

  • Paket installieren:
    apt-get install munin-node
  • folgende Zeile in /etc/munin/munin-node.conf einfügen:
    allow ^192\.168\.10\.13$
  • den Dienst neustarten:
    service munin-node restart

Hinweis: Sollte unterhalb von /home ein Mount-Point bestehen, so muss für das DF (Disk Free) Monitoring eine Anpassung vorgenommen werden, siehe Opennet DEV Ticket 235.

[Bearbeiten] Datenerfassung auf Access Points (OpenWrt)

  • Paket installieren:
    opkg install muninlite
  • Dienst aktivieren:
    /etc/init.d/xinetd enable; /etc/init.d/xinetd start

[Bearbeiten] Datenerfassung auf Access Points (Opennet Firmware)

  • hierzu das "on-monitoring" Modul installieren
Meine Werkzeuge
Namensräume

Varianten
Aktionen
Start
Opennet
Kommunikation
Karten
Werkzeuge